ورود

View Full Version : سوال: نحوه ی اتصال وبی 6 به sql2008



milad.biroonvand
دوشنبه 20 دی 1389, 18:19 عصر
سلام

دوستان ، من هرکاری می کنم از وبی 6 به sql2008 متصل شوم ف نمی تونم ، کسی میدونه به چه صورت میشه وصل شد .

از کد زیر که استفاده می کنم خطا میگیره :


Dim cn As New ADODB.connection
Dim rs As New ADODB.Recordset


cn.Open "Provider=SQLOLEDB.1;User ID=sa;password=;Initial Catalog=Master;Data Source = (Local);"
rs.Open "SELECT * FROM sys.databases", cn, adOpenStatic, adLockOptimistic


کارهای زیر رو هم انجام دادم

از منوی پروژه(Project) گزینه References رو انتخاب می کنیم
http://i35.tinypic.com/ddeuxg.jpg

از صفحه باز شده گزینه Microsoft ActiveX Data Objects 6.0 Library رو انتخاب کنین:
http://i34.tinypic.com/xni90i.jpg

در حقیقت ما با این کار به کتابخانه VB یه سری اشیا اضافه کردیم. می دونم این جمله، عین این کتابای درپیت تو بازار شد به خاطر همین بیشتر توضیح می دم.
وقتی می خوایم یه متغیر رو تعریف کنیم، می نویسیم Dim A as String، وقتی می خوایم نوع متغیر رو تعریف کنیم(در اینجا String) یه لیستی رو VB باز می کنه که اسم انواع متغیر ها توشه. حالا وقتی ما Microsoft ActiveX Data Objects 6.0 Library رو به پروژمون اضافه می کنیم یه سری گزینه به اون لیسته اضافه می شه و در حقیقت ما می تونیم متغیر ها رو با انواع بیشتری تعریف کنیم.